Google Search Generative Experience (SGE) Shutdown: What It Means for AI Content Strategy in 2025

Source: Search Engine Journal | Key Insight: Google confirmed the shutdown of its Search Generative Experience (SGE) on July 22, 2025, marking a strategic retreat from AI-generated search summaries and a renewed focus on the core link-based web. This pivot signals a major correction in the search giant’s public AI roadmap, forcing content creators to recalibrate their strategies away from optimizing for AI overviews and back toward foundational SEO principles.

The Rise and Fall of Google SGE: A 20-Month Experiment

Launched in November 2023 as part of Google’s Search Labs, SGE represented the company’s most ambitious attempt to integrate generative AI directly into the search results page (SERP). The feature used Google’s Gemini models to synthesize information from multiple sources, presenting users with an AI-generated summary or “snapshot” at the top of results for complex queries. For nearly two years, it was positioned as the future of search—a shift from a “10 blue links” model to an answer-engine interface.

According to Google’s official announcement, SGE will be fully deactivated across all regions and languages by July 22, 2025. The company cited several factors for the shutdown:

  • User Preference for Control: Data indicated that a significant portion of users skipped the SGE snapshot to scroll directly to traditional organic results, preferring to evaluate source credibility themselves.
  • Publisher Ecosystem Strain: The feature was widely criticized for potentially reducing click-through rates to publisher websites, as answers were often provided directly in the summary.
  • Computational Cost vs. Value: Generating high-quality, real-time AI overviews for billions of queries proved enormously resource-intensive, with Google questioning the long-term return on investment.
  • Accuracy and Legal Challenges: Maintaining factual accuracy and navigating copyright implications for synthesized content presented ongoing operational and legal hurdles.

This decision follows a gradual scaling back of SGE features throughout early 2025, including the removal of AI-generated summaries for local and shopping queries. The shutdown is not an abandonment of AI in search—tools like Gemini-powered “AI-organized” results and multi-step reasoning remain—but it is a definitive end to the experiment of placing generative AI answers at the very top of the SERP.

Immediate Impact on AI Content Creators and SEOs

The removal of SGE dismantles a hypothetical future that many content strategies were built around. For professionals using platforms like EasyAuthor.ai, Jasper, or ChatGPT for content creation, the implications are immediate and require a strategic shift.

1. The End of “SGE-Optimized” Content

A nascent industry of “SGE optimization” tools and tactics is now obsolete. Strategies focused on getting content cited in the AI snapshot—such as targeting “information gain” queries, using specific data formats, or employing conversational Q&A structures purely for AI parsing—no longer have a target. The primary KPI reverts solely to securing a high organic ranking and click.

2. A Return to Classic SEO Fundamentals

With SGE gone, the SERP real estate battle simplifies. The focus returns unequivocally to:

  • E-E-A-T (Experience, Expertise, Authoritativeness, Trustworthiness): Google’s renewed public statements emphasize rewarding content from demonstrably expert sources. AI-generated content without strong editorial oversight and clear authorship signals will face greater scrutiny.
  • Link Equity and Domain Authority: The value of a backlink profile and historical domain strength is re-emphasized, as these remain core to Google’s ranking algorithms outside of experimental features.
  • User Intent and Content Depth: Creating comprehensive, user-focused content that fully satisfies search intent becomes paramount, as there is no AI summary to act as a middleman.

3. Re-evaluation of AI Content Volume Strategies

Many publishers increased content production volume using AI, operating under the assumption that more content fragments would increase chances of being sourced by SGE. This “spray and pray” approach loses its rationale. The efficiency calculus for AI content must now weigh pure organic ranking potential against the risk of producing thin or duplicative material that could harm site quality signals.

Practical Tips for AI-Assisted Content Creation Post-SGE

This shift does not invalidate AI content creation; it refines its purpose. Here’s how to adapt your workflow in tools like EasyAuthor.ai, WordPress, and your overall SEO process.

1. Double Down on Original Research and Expert Synthesis

AI’s greatest strength is synthesizing information, not originating it. Use AI as a research assistant and drafting tool, but anchor all content in unique data, original testing, or verifiable expert commentary. Prompt your AI tools accordingly:

  • Instead of: “Write a 1500-word article on the best CRM software.”
  • Try: “Using this spreadsheet of my team’s 3-month test results for [Software A, B, C], including scores for usability, integration, and cost, draft a comparative analysis article highlighting our key findings and a final recommendation.”

2. Implement Rigorous Human-Editing and Fact-Checking Gates

Establish a non-negotiable workflow where all AI-generated drafts pass through a human editor for:

  • Fact Verification: Check all statistics, dates, and claims against primary sources.
  • Argument and Logic: Ensure the narrative flows logically and conclusions are supported.
  • Brand Voice and Expertise Injection: Inject specific anecdotes, professional insights, or brand perspective that an AI cannot replicate.

3. Optimize for “Click-Worthiness” in Titles and Meta Descriptions

With no AI summary to pre-consume information, the title tag and meta description regain immense importance as your ad to the searcher. Use AI to generate multiple compelling options, then A/B test them. Focus on clarity, benefit, and a hint of curiosity that prompts a click.

4. Leverage AI for Content Enhancement, Not Just Generation

Shift your AI tool usage beyond first drafts. Use it for:

  • Auditing and Updating Old Content: Prompt AI to identify outdated information in existing posts and suggest updates.
  • Creating Truly Useful Supplementary Content: Generate FAQs, checklists, or glossary definitions that add depth to a core, human-crafted article.
  • Technical SEO Tasks: Automate the generation of XML sitemaps, structured data markup (JSON-LD), or internal linking suggestions within your WordPress CMS.

5. Monitor Core Web Vitals and Page Experience Closely

As competition for organic clicks intensifies, page experience becomes a greater differentiator. Use automation tools to ensure your AI-augmented content site loads quickly, is mobile-friendly, and free of intrusive interstitials. A slow site will negate any content quality gains.

Looking Forward: AI Content in a Post-SGE Landscape

The shutdown of Google SGE is a clarifying moment for the AI content industry. It ends a period of speculation and reinforces that search’s fundamental currency remains trusted, valuable, and clickable information. For savvy creators, this is an opportunity.

The most successful content operations will use AI as a force multiplier for human expertise, not a replacement. The strategy moves from “creating content for AI” to “using AI to create better content for humans.” This means investing in editorial processes, niche authority, and content depth. Tools like EasyAuthor.ai that facilitate a collaborative human-AI workflow—emphasizing planning, sourcing, and editing—will be better positioned than those promising fully automated, hands-off content generation.

While Google will continue to integrate AI in other forms, the SGE experiment demonstrates that the user’s desire for choice, transparency, and direct access to sources is a powerful force. By aligning your AI content strategy with these enduring principles, you build a foundation that is resilient to any future algorithmic change.
